While as I stated, there is no known audience shot video, there is "pro-shot" and permission shot video of the show.
VH-1 showed a short 10 second clip on the Rock Show of their 1 professional camera set up at the soundboard with a soundboard audio feed. People associated with Twisted Sister also filmed Anthrax's set, as well as TS, with 3 mini-dv consumer camcorders from various angles.
One of those angles is what you see on the Anthrax BTM.
I would guess that members of Anthrax have this 3 cam mini-dv shoot, but that's only a guess. You can watch a few songs of the TS 3 cam shoot on
